A Money Market Fund (MMF) is a type of mutual fund that invests in short-term, low-risk financial instruments such as treasury bills, commercial papers, and fixed deposits. The goal of an MMF is to provide investors with liquidity, security, and returns that often outperform regular savings accounts.
Key Features of Money Market Funds:
- Liquidity: Easily access your money whenever needed, making it ideal for emergency savings.
- Low Risk: MMFs invest in secure, short-term assets, reducing exposure to market volatility.
- Professional Management: Funds are managed by financial experts who optimize returns while minimizing risks.
- Competitive Returns: MMFs offer better interest rates compared to traditional savings accounts.
How Money Market Funds Work in Nigeria
In Nigeria, MMFs are regulated by the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) and typically invest in government securities and corporate debt instruments. Investors can start with as little as ₦5,000, making MMFs accessible to everyone. Returns depend on market conditions, but they generally provide higher yields than savings accounts.
